This tender is for hiring a ladder jeep vehicle (Non-AC) for the Coastal Sub Division of DGVCL in Valsad. The vehicle must be in latest condition, not older than 3 months, and capable of 24-hour duty with a driver. The contract duration is 36 months, with a monthly mileage limit of up to 3000 Kms. The contractor will cover costs for diesel, insurance, and maintenance, ensuring reliable transportation for power distribution operations in the coastal region.
Eligible bidders include vehicle leasing companies, transport service providers, and contractors with experience in government vehicle services. Bidders must have valid vehicle registration, commercial licenses, GST registration, and demonstrate technical capability by providing recent, well-maintained vehicles. Financial stability and experience in similar contracts are also mandatory.
The bid submission starts on 31-01-2026 at 13:32 and ends on 10-02-2026 at 18:10. The technical evaluation will be conducted on 11-02-2026 at 11:05, followed by the commercial bid opening at 11:30 on the same day. Bidders should ensure timely submission of all documents, including EMD, technical, and financial bids, via the official online portal.
The vehicle must be a latest model ladder jeep (non-AC), not older than 3 months, with a minimum engine capacity of 1500 cc. It should be capable of 24-hour operation, with safety features like seat belts, fire extinguisher, and first aid kit. The vehicle must pass emission standards and be suitable for power sector operational needs. Regular maintenance and inspections are mandatory throughout the contract period.
Bids are evaluated based on technical compliance (50%), past experience (20%), and cost competitiveness (30%). A minimum of 70% in technical evaluation is required for qualification. The financial proposals are scored comparatively, with the highest scoring bid winning. Factors like vehicle condition, bidder experience, cost efficiency, and compliance with safety norms are critical in the evaluation process.
